Deep End Clusters

Most of the Deep End practices are in the Valleys and urban areas. In May 2026 we identified 20 of the 60 clusters in Wales who have the same proportion (over34%) of their patients living in the most deprived communities OR those where a majority of their practices are Deep End. 

The Deep End Clusters are:
